The Video News Producer is responsible for identifying, creating, and sourcing high-impact visual assets to enhance Newsweek's journalism across multiple platforms. They must monitor breaking news and optimize video content to drive audience engagement and dwell time.
Newsweek is the global media organization that has earned audience time and trust for more than 90 years. Newsweek reaches 100 million people each month with thought-provoking news, opinion, images, graphics, and video delivered across a dozen print and digital platforms. Headquartered in New York City, Newsweek also publishes international editions in EMEA and Asia.
Newsweek is seeking a Video News Producer to deliver high-quality, timely, and platform-optimized video and visual storytelling that strengthens our journalism and drives audience engagement. This role is central to how we present news - treating visuals as a core editorial component, not a supplement.
The Video News Producer will work at the heart of a fast-paced newsroom, identifying and producing compelling video, graphics, and visual assets that enhance stories across our CMS, social platforms, and YouTube. The scheduled shift for this position will run from 10:30 pm IST - 6:30 am IST five days a week.
